The "20V MAX" Naming Convention Explained

You might be wondering about the "MAX" in 20V MAX. This is a crucial point that often leads to confusion. DeWalt, like many other manufacturers, uses the "MAX" designation to indicate the peak voltage a battery can achieve when fully charged. The nominal voltage (the standard operating voltage) of these batteries is actually closer to 18V. However, the *peak* voltage is what matters for power delivery and performance claims. So, while they are marketed as 20V MAX, they are effectively the next generation of the 18V platform, offering a significant performance upgrade without alienating users with a completely different voltage standard.

What About My Existing 18V DeWalt Tools?

This is a common concern for users who have invested heavily in the DeWalt 18V system. While DeWalt no longer actively produces new 18V tools or batteries, they understand the loyalty of their customer base. Here's what you need to know:

  • Continued Support for a Period: DeWalt typically maintains support for older platforms for a reasonable period. This means you can often still find replacement parts and service for your existing 18V tools.
  • Battery Replacements: Finding new 18V DeWalt batteries might become increasingly challenging over time. However, some third-party manufacturers may still produce compatible batteries, though it's always recommended to research their quality and safety carefully.
  • The Upgrade Path: The most practical solution for many is to gradually transition to the 20V MAX system. Start by replacing your most frequently used tools and then expand your collection as needed. DeWalt often offers "tool-only" options, allowing you to use your new 20V MAX batteries with these tools, saving money.

Is DeWalt 18V the same as 20V MAX?

No, they are not the same, but they are closely related. The "20V MAX" designation refers to the peak voltage of the battery when fully charged, while the nominal voltage is closer to 18V. The 20V MAX system provides a significant performance upgrade over the older 18V platform.

Can I use 20V MAX DeWalt batteries on 18V tools?

Generally, no. The battery connectors and voltage output are different. Attempting to use a 20V MAX battery on an 18V tool could potentially damage the tool or the battery. It's always best to use batteries designed for the specific tool system.
